Credo Unveils Bluebird 1.6T Optical DSP for Low-Power, High-Bandwidth, and Ultra-low Latency AI Networks

SHENZHEN, China--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d (Credo) (NASDAQ: CRDO), an innovator in providing secure, high-speed connectivity solutions that deliver improved reliability and energy efficiency for the next generation of AI driven applications, cloud computing, and hyperscale networks, today announced its high-performance, low-power Bluebird Digital Signal Processor (DSP) for 1.6Tbps optical transceivers. This breakthrough technology enables energy-efficient 224Gbps per lane PAM4 data transmission essential to unlocking the advanced computational power of state-of-the-art GPU silicon.

Next-generation AI networks require high-bandwidth, ultra-low latency, extreme reliability, and exceptional power efficiency. Many existing 1.6T transceivers suffer from high levels of power dissipation, constraining deployments due to the challenges with cooling and power delivery. This places limits on the widespread adoption of 1.6T technology. The Credo Bluebird DSP aims to address these challenges by leveraging advanced CMOS process technology and Credo’s proprietary design techniques to deliver industry-leading power efficiency, allowing 1.6T transceivers to consume well under 20W.

Bluebird features four or eight lanes of 224Gbps PAM4 to support high density 800G, or high-capacity 1.6T optical transceivers. It is available in full DSP and Linear Receive Optics (LRO) variants to address a wide variety of networking architecture options for both scale-up and scale-out use cases.

To reduce bottlenecks in GPU-to-GPU communications, Bluebird has been carefully architected to maintain latency below 40ns in each direction. This ultra-low latency enhances computational efficiency and performance during large language model (LLM) training as well as inference. Bluebird also includes a suite of telemetry features to enable link monitoring and diagnostics, maximizing system uptime and reliability. These same features further assist with failure isolation, debug, and production testing.

For seamless optical transceiver integration, optical component selection and host ASIC interoperability, the Bluebird DSP integrates a strategically tailored suite of performance optimization features for both electrical and optical interfaces. These features can be dynamically enabled to maximize link margin in challenging environments or disabled to optimize energy consumption in dense clusters. Optional IEEE compliant inner and outer Forward Error Correction (FEC) are included to support fiber reaches of 500 m, 2 km and beyond, allowing customers to leverage a common design for different applications.
